Holice 10-26-2010 10:30 AM

Ann's in Canton is on your way.
If you leave the Pike at Exit 9 - Sturbridge.
There is a small shop Quilting Cabbage in Strbridge
Down Rt 20 in Charlton is The Charlton Sewing Center. in an old church.
On down is Appletree Fabrics in Auburn - Also on Rt 20
Wellsley has The Button Box
If you go south on Rt 95 there is Quilt Stash in North Attleboro.
